As a Senior Manager of PPI Business System at Thermo Fisher Scientific, you will facilitate transformational change and continuous improvement across the organization. Leading the implementation of our Practical Process Improvement (PPI) Business System, you will partner with business leaders to establish and mature lean management practices that enable profitable growth, enhance customer experience, and increase employee engagement. Through strategic deployment, coaching, and hands-on facilitation of improvement initiatives, you will help develop a problem-solving culture focused on operational excellence. You'll collaborate with cross-functional teams to streamline processes, eliminate waste, and deliver measurable results in quality, productivity, and customer satisfaction.
REQUIREMENTS:
• Advanced Degree plus 6 years of experience, or Bachelor's Degree plus 8 years of experience in lean leadership implementing continuous improvement initiatives
• Preferred Fields of Study: Engineering, Science, Business, Operations or related field
• Six Sigma Black Belt and/or Lean certification preferred
• Project Management Professional (PMP) certification a plus
• Demonstrated experience developing and deploying PPI/lean tools including:
• Strategy deployment and value stream mapping
• Tiered daily management systems and leader standard work
• Kaizen facilitation and problem-solving methodologies
• Standard work, error-proofing, and visual management
• Strong financial and business acumen with ability to identify, quantify and track improvement opportunities
• Excellent communication, presentation and influence skills to engage all organizational levels
• Demonstrated success coaching and developing continuous improvement capabilities in others
• Experience leading change initiatives in a matrix organization
• Strong project management skills and ability to manage multiple priorities
• Ability to travel up to 30%
• Manufacturing/operations experience preferred
• Expertise in data analytics and performance metrics
• Proficiency in Microsoft Office suite required
• Commitment to driving improvement and leading transformational change
• Ability to work effectively across functions without direct authority
• Experience in regulated industry (e.g., life sciences, medical devices) preferred
About the company
Thermo Fisher Scientific
Large Enterprise
Thermo Fisher Scientific is a global leader in serving science, providing a wide range of analytical instruments, reagents, and software solutions for healthcare, pharmaceuticals, and life sciences research. With a commitment to innovation and quality, the company enables customers to make significant advancements in scientific discovery and healthcare diagnostics. Thermo Fisher operates in more than 50 countries and employs over 80,000 people, fostering a collaborative environment aimed at enhancing global health and safety. Through its broad portfolio of brands and technologies, the company plays a vital role in accelerating life-changing research and improving patient outcomes worldwide.
